The modern bolt-action rifle with the Haenel arrow: straightforward and target-oriented. Functional and practical: The Jäger 10 is manufactured with the latest technology. The high-strength three-lug bolt runs perfectly in the cold-forged action sleeve with the best surface and sliding properties. This system corresponds in precision with the cold-forged Suhl barrels. The opening angle of only 60 degrees allows for quick cycling. Additionally, a fine trigger – and a removable magazine for quick magazine changes. Everything a lightweight and maneuverable all-rounder needs. 2-position safety. Synthetic stock with SoftTouch coating. The Haenel Jäger 10 stands out for its excellent price/performance ratio and is 100% “Made in Germany.” The Jäger 10 is offered in various model variants, from the higher-quality Timber version in wood class 4, two variants with camouflage surface, three Varmint versions, as well as a short Tracker and a precision rifle. The stock of this maneuverable bolt-action rifle features a straight back, with a long German cheek piece depending on the version. The synthetic stocks are made from the latest high-tech plastic. All metal parts are matte blued. Female hunters can rely on a special ladies' stock. In this case, the buttstock has been shortened, the pistol grip is steeper, and a cushioning butt pad reduces recoil. These features enable a female-typical shooting position. The bolt features six large lugs on the chamber head and runs perfectly in the action sleeve with excellent surface and sliding properties. The opening angle of only 60 degrees allows for both quick cycling and a very flat scope mounting. The trigger is a direct trigger that stands dry. By opening the chamber, it is automatically de-cocked. The removable magazine consists of a steel sheet body and holds 3 + 1 cartridges as standard. The rifle comes standard with a driven hunt sight with illuminated front sight. The safety is located to the right of the trigger and has a separate chamber lock that allows unloading in a secured state. The Jäger 10 allows for the mounting of a Remington 700 mounting base. On this base, all Remington 700 mounts can be built. Some Jäger 10 models (e.g., Jäger 10 Varmint) are equipped with a Picatinny rail as standard; this rail can be mounted on all other Jäger 10 models from the factory for an additional charge. This allows for the easy mounting of all common scopes. All scopes feature an aluminum tube body with an extremely insensitive, satin matte, hard-anodized surface. 30 mm main tube diameter for trouble-free mounting. The reticle 4A or the Leu
chtpunkt are located in the ocular plane (2nd image plane) and therefore remain constant in size. The illumination unit is located in the turret area and can be optimally adjusted to the respective ambient light over 11 levels. Precise elevation and windage adjustment in 1/4 MOA increments. Broadband multi-coating for maximum light transmission and optical performance. Eye relief approx. 95 mm.
